国产精品久久久久久亚洲影视,性爱视频一区二区,亚州综合图片,欧美成人午夜免费视在线看片

意見箱
恒創(chuàng)運營部門將仔細參閱您的意見和建議,必要時將通過預(yù)留郵箱與您保持聯(lián)絡(luò)。感謝您的支持!
意見/建議
提交建議

美國Web服務(wù)器容器化部署與微服務(wù)架構(gòu)的關(guān)系與優(yōu)勢

來源:佚名 編輯:佚名
2024-08-08 13:08:47

在現(xiàn)代軟件開發(fā)中,容器化部署和微服務(wù)架構(gòu)已成為兩種重要的趨勢。尤其是在美國,越來越多的企業(yè)通過將Web服務(wù)器容器化,與微服務(wù)架構(gòu)相結(jié)合,實現(xiàn)靈活性、可擴展性和高效性。本文將探討容器化部署與微服務(wù)架構(gòu)之間的關(guān)系,以及它們各自帶來的優(yōu)勢,幫助讀者理解這種組合如何推動現(xiàn)代應(yīng)用開發(fā)和運營的變革。

一、引言

隨著云計算技術(shù)的快速發(fā)展,企業(yè)在構(gòu)建和部署Web應(yīng)用時面臨著日益復(fù)雜的需求。容器化和微服務(wù)架構(gòu)應(yīng)運而生,成為解決這些挑戰(zhàn)的重要手段。容器化允許開發(fā)人員將應(yīng)用及其所有依賴項打包在一個獨立的環(huán)境中,而微服務(wù)架構(gòu)則將應(yīng)用拆分為一組小型、獨立的服務(wù)。兩者的結(jié)合使得開發(fā)、測試和生產(chǎn)等各個環(huán)節(jié)的效率大幅提升。

二、容器化部署與微服務(wù)架構(gòu)的關(guān)系

1. 自然契合

容器化與微服務(wù)架構(gòu)是相輔相成的。微服務(wù)架構(gòu)將大型應(yīng)用拆分為多個小服務(wù),而每個服務(wù)可以作為一個獨立的容器進行運行。這種結(jié)構(gòu)使得開發(fā)團隊能夠獨立地對每個服務(wù)進行更新和擴展,從而減少了系統(tǒng)間的耦合度。

2. 獨立性與隔離性

每個微服務(wù)在容器中獨立運行,確保了服務(wù)之間的隔離性。無論是操作系統(tǒng)環(huán)境還是依賴庫版本,都可以被單獨管理,這樣就避免了“依賴地獄”問題,提高了系統(tǒng)的穩(wěn)定性。

3. 自動化與編排工具的支持

許多容器編排工具(如Kubernetes、Docker Swarm)專為微服務(wù)架構(gòu)設(shè)計,提供自動化部署、擴展和管理的能力。這使得服務(wù)的生命周期管理更加高效,尤其在需要頻繁進行部署和更新的場景下。

三、容器化部署與微服務(wù)架構(gòu)的優(yōu)勢

1. 提高開發(fā)效率

容器化讓開發(fā)人員可以創(chuàng)建一致的開發(fā)環(huán)境,從而避免因環(huán)境差異導(dǎo)致的問題。結(jié)合微服務(wù)架構(gòu),各團隊可以并行開發(fā)不同的服務(wù),加快整體開發(fā)進程。

2. 便于自動化和持續(xù)集成/持續(xù)交付(CI/CD)

借助容器化,構(gòu)建和部署流程可以實現(xiàn)完全自動化,使得代碼變更后能迅速推送到生產(chǎn)環(huán)境。同時,微服務(wù)架構(gòu)允許使用獨立的CI/CD管道,為每個服務(wù)設(shè)置不同的發(fā)布策略,增強了靈活性。

3. 靈活的資源管理

容器化使得資源的使用更加高效,能夠根據(jù)不同服務(wù)的需求動態(tài)分配資源。結(jié)合微服務(wù)架構(gòu),企業(yè)可以根據(jù)實際負載情況進行自動縮放,以應(yīng)對流量波動。

4. 增強系統(tǒng)可靠性

微服務(wù)架構(gòu)允許通過服務(wù)的冗余和故障轉(zhuǎn)移機制提高系統(tǒng)的可靠性。容器化進一步促進了這一點,因其可以快速重啟或替換發(fā)生故障的容器,確保服務(wù)的高可用性。

5. 技術(shù)選型自由

由于每個微服務(wù)都可以獨立運行,企業(yè)可以選擇最適合該服務(wù)的技術(shù)棧。容器化支持多種語言和框架的運行,從而避免了技術(shù)上的鎖定。

四、總結(jié)

美國Web服務(wù)器的容器化部署與微服務(wù)架構(gòu)為企業(yè)提供了一種有效的解決方案,以應(yīng)對現(xiàn)代應(yīng)用開發(fā)中的復(fù)雜性和不確定性。兩者的結(jié)合不僅提高了開發(fā)效率,還增強了系統(tǒng)的靈活性和可靠性。在當前數(shù)字化轉(zhuǎn)型的背景下,企業(yè)若能充分利用容器化和微服務(wù)架構(gòu),將能夠在競爭中占據(jù)先機,不斷滿足市場變化和用戶需求。

本網(wǎng)站發(fā)布或轉(zhuǎn)載的文章均來自網(wǎng)絡(luò),其原創(chuàng)性以及文中表達的觀點和判斷不代表本網(wǎng)站。
上一篇: 美國服務(wù)器租用的定制化服務(wù):滿足多樣化需求 下一篇: 美國網(wǎng)站服務(wù)器常見的遠程控制方式